Walle - 瓦力 上线部署系统支持多用户、多项目、多环境同时部署。相比jenkins其项目配置更简单、回滚快速、权限分级、用户分组功能更完善;好吧至少UI界面更优雅,用户体验更人性,大大方便了开发者和管理者的持续交付开发。支持各种web语言代码发布,静态的HTML、动态PHP、需要编译的JAVA等。
其最大特点是对git版本的分支、tag可自定义在测试、预发布,生产环境部署,开发者和测试同学协作迭代开发上线,无论是milestone或者feature小步快走式上线都可支持。v0.7.5版本新增了一系列新功能,现在已经支持到svn版本管理,增加完整的安装手册、使用说明文档,以及修正一些bug
如果需要一个web部署系统来代替手工或者脚本发布代码,不妨试用这个吧:),请试用反馈以帮助更出色。

引用来自“小A”的评论
我安装完成后访问跳到 /site/login,请问楼主是什么原因呢引用来自“zzcv”的评论
@wushuiyong 安装完毕,Nginx调整完毕,访问页面502,哪里有日志可以查啊2.安装compxx组件,以及yii2+百度网盘copy楼主提供的nexx组件成功,并导入数据库成功
3.调整Nginx配置文件访问路径至git clone目录,启动Nginx,然后就没有然后了………
引用来自“gloomyzerg”的评论
我在post_deploy 里面修改了一些文件 在代码检出仓库的文件夹下内容也改变了 但是发布版本库中的文件内容还是git里面的内容 是怎么回事呢?引用来自“wushuiyong”的评论
提个issue,贴下问题,我给追查下引用来自“zzcv”的评论
安装部署我觉得开发还是该考虑下,引用来自“运维技术”的评论
已经安装测试了一下有几个问题
1.支持秘钥认证的部署么?
2.怎么做多服务或者批量部署
3.无详细日志输出在页面,像jk的终端,建议有一个api的接口,这个接口用户可以自定义,对部署成功或者失败做一个提示或者消息
2毫无疑问支持,目标机群写多个即可
3成功不需要展示日志,失败才会有错误提示
引用来自“zzcv”的评论
安装部署我觉得开发还是该考虑下,有几个问题
1.支持秘钥认证的部署么?
2.怎么做多服务或者批量部署
3.无详细日志输出在页面,像jk的终端,建议有一个api的接口,这个接口用户可以自定义,对部署成功或者失败做一个提示或者消息
引用来自“记忆的美好”的评论
小白表示费了半天劲没搞定,能出个更更详细的说明吗?引用来自“小海bug”的评论
额 有跑起来的没引用来自“gloomyzerg”的评论
我在post_deploy 里面修改了一些文件 在代码检出仓库的文件夹下内容也改变了 但是发布版本库中的文件内容还是git里面的内容 是怎么回事呢?引用来自“quickbird”的评论
这个是热部署?引用来自“thrmgr”的评论
很厉害的样子, JK用得蛋都碎了...马上试用一下
马上试用一下
引用来自“墨龙”的评论
装不上的说,报错呢composer install --prefer-dist --no-dev --optimize-autoloader -vvvv
这一步报错
引用来自“wushuiyong”的评论
提个issue贴错误吧,我帮看下引用来自“墨龙”的评论
贴不了图片啊引用来自“wushuiyong”的评论
可以的,到github项目底部有一个submit issue链接,ctr + v 就可以引用来自“墨龙”的评论
装不上的说,报错呢composer install --prefer-dist --no-dev --optimize-autoloader -vvvv
这一步报错
引用来自“wushuiyong”的评论
提个issue贴错误吧,我帮看下引用来自“墨龙”的评论
贴不了图片啊引用来自“这个世界不真实”的评论
我就说一句:public static void main(String [] args){
}
引用来自“renyi1986”的评论
一个字 JAVA滚System.out.println("你先滚");
}
引用来自“墨龙”的评论
装不上的说,报错呢composer install --prefer-dist --no-dev --optimize-autoloader -vvvv
这一步报错
composer install --prefer-dist --no-dev --optimize-autoloader -vvvv
这一步报错
引用来自“独钓渔”的评论
能否详细写一下工作原理。